As an HVAC technician, you'll be responsible for installing, repairing, and maintaining he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ems. When interviewing for an HVAC technician position, you can expect to be asked a variety of questions related to your technical skills, experience, and problem solving abilities. Some common HVAC technician interview questions include: Can you explain your experience with HVAC systems? What types of HVAC systems are you comfortable working with? How do you troubleshoot HVAC problems? Can you describe a time when you had to fix a particularly challenging HVAC issue? How do you ensure the safety of yourself and others when working with HVAC systems? How do you stay up to date on industry developments and changes in technology? In addition to technical questions, employers may also ask behavioral questions to assess your communication skills, teamwork abilities, and work ethic. For example: Can you describe a time when you went above and beyond in your work? How do you handle conflicts with coworkers or customers? How do you prioritize tasks when working on multiple projects at once? It's important to prepare for your HVAC technician interview by reviewing common technical questions and practicing your answers. You should also research the company and be prepared to ask questions about their specific HVAC systems and processes. Overall, the key to a successful HVAC technician interview is to demonstrate your technical knowledge, problem solving abilities, and dedication to safety and customer satisfaction.
